Output 83dfe9cdca7a940020789fc43fd724f3575f8445cd01e92f8e25a6d11331c6f0:0

value
670021805
script pubkey
OP_HASH160 OP_PUSHBYTES_20 79a88f989eca67f7072237536b6c050e0f0b96ce OP_EQUAL
address
MJzRvTdKdaDCHq5rZGJm9PEfxMACytPBaY
transaction
83dfe9cdca7a940020789fc43fd724f3575f8445cd01e92f8e25a6d11331c6f0
spent
true